Mr. Chairman, let us be straight about some facts. Since 1981, we have spent more than we have collected in receipts and interest in these funds. The way we measure the deficit is expenditures versus revenue. In 1994 and 1995, the expenditures from the highway trust fund have exceeded total revenue. The same is true in the airport trust fund. They are not subsidizing the balance of the budget.
